According to the search results, derma rollers can be used for hair growth through a process called microneedling. The tiny needles on the roller puncture the scalp, stimulating increased collagen and elastin production and blood circulation to the hair follicles, which enhances nutrient delivery and the absorption of topical treatments. It is important to note that most studies investigate the effects of microneedling alongside another therapy, such as minoxidil, and there is not enough research evaluating the use of derma rollers on their own for hair loss. Therefore, it is recommended to use derma rollers in conjunction with other topical products, such as hair loss serums. It is also important to sanitize the derma roller after every use and replace it as soon as signs of wear and tear start appearing.
